Digital Tools for Personal Health Management
Required Outcomes and Benchmarks
Grants aimed at developing digital health tools for chronic illness management require organizations to set specific health outcome goals. For instance, one common benchmark is reducing emergency room visits related to chronic diseases by a defined percentage within a set timeframe, usually aiming for a 10-15% decrease in the first year of implementation. Achieving such metrics not only demonstrates the tool's effectiveness but also reinforces its necessity in the healthcare spectrum.
Essential KPIs to Track
Key Performance Indicators (KPIs) for these initiatives often include user engagement rates, adherence to prescribed health regimens, and user-reported health outcomes after using the digital tool. Tracking these metrics allows organizations to measure the effectiveness of their interventions. Additionally, customer satisfaction scores can provide crucial insights into app usability and effectiveness in managing personal health.
Evaluation and Reporting Requirements
Organizations must establish clear evaluation frameworks that outline how they will measure the performance of digital health tools. Regular reporting intervals are typically required, often on a quarterly basis, to assess progress against targets. Grantees should be prepared to submit comprehensive reports that detail both qualitative user experiences and quantitative data showing improvements or declines in health outcomes.
Performance Thresholds
Performance thresholds are often set to ensure accountability. For example, organizations may be required to achieve at least 75% of their stated health outcome goals within the initial grant period. Failing to meet these thresholds may result in a reduction of funding or lack of eligibility for future grants, thereby underscoring the importance of setting achievable yet ambitious targets.
